dc.description | This document details about enzymes as biological catalysts, quality indicators and development in plants. Enzymes play a vital role in agriculture and in the nutrient cycling, because they constantly synthesize, accumulate, inactivate and decompose the soil. Therefore, it was determined that catalytic enzymes improve the quality of plants, from the seed due to various genetic components, to the development of plants due to their physiological characteristics; All enzymes can be catalyzed by plants; are biomolecules of a protein nature that accelerate the reaction rate until reaching an equilibrium, which constitute the most numerous type of protein that acts as catalysts for specific chemical reactions in living beings or biological systems and amino acids, peptides and proteins improve plantations and consequently they influence the good yield of the crop. | es_ES |
